This Foodie's Look to St. Louis Classics

No visit to St. Louis is whole without indulging in the city’s iconic eats. Forget the fancy restaurants; we're diving headfirst into a genuine, time-honored experiences. Start with a St. Louis-style pizza – crispy crust, Provel cheese which is a local obsession. Then, grab some toasted ravioli, a deep-fried, breaded marvel served with marinara dip. For a sweet, don’t overlook gooey butter cake, a decadent treat that's pure addictive. And of course, you'll must taste frozen custard from one of the respected establishments like Ted Drewes - a creamy delight!

St. Louis BBQ: Where to Find the Best Ribs

Seeking traditional St. Louis BBQ experiences ? The region is renowned for its distinctive style of pork read more ribs, often cut spare ribs glazed in a sweet and tangy rub . Several establishments vie for the title of "best," but top stand out. Visit Pappy's Smokehouse for a legendary experience, or explore Bogart's Smokehouse for a slightly different take . Remember to also look into Hammer’s BBQ & Blues for a fantastic pairing of food and blues . Finding the perfect rack of ribs is a quest , but St. Louis makes it rewarding .
